The Importance of Compliance and Documentation
Compliance remains one of the most important considerations when selecting a medical brace manufacturer for DME organizations.
Providers must ensure products meet payer requirements and support accurate documentation processes.
Important Compliance Considerations Include:
- PDAC-related product standards
- HCPCS coding alignment
- Product traceability
- Documentation support
- Consistent product specifications
When products vary between orders or manufacturers, providers may face billing inconsistencies or increased administrative burden.
An experienced bulk orthopedic brace supply partner understands the operational realities of DME workflows and helps minimize disruptions.
How Bulk Purchasing Supports Operational Efficiency
Purchasing medical support braces in bulk can significantly improve operational efficiency for growing DME organizations.
Benefits of Bulk Ordering Include:
Lower Procurement Costs
Bulk purchasing often improves pricing consistency and helps reduce per-unit costs.
Better Inventory Planning
Consistent ordering patterns allow providers to forecast inventory more accurately.
Reduced Administrative Work
Managing fewer vendors simplifies purchasing, invoicing, and operational coordination.
Improved Product Consistency
Using standardized products across locations helps reduce staff confusion and documentation errors.
Faster Patient Fulfillment
Maintaining inventory on hand improves responsiveness for urgent patient needs.
For multi-location practices and larger DME providers, centralized sourcing through a trusted bulk-brace supplier can deliver measurable operational improvements.
